Sourcing Standards
We prioritise primary sources and official documents. Typical sources include:
- Income Tax Department / CBDT circulars, Finance Act, India Code and Gazette notifications.
- RBI master directions, press releases and FAQs.
- SEBI regulations, exchange circulars and scheme documents.
- Official portals (NSDL/Protean, CAMS, EPFO, India Post) and regulator FAQs.
Where third-party data is used, we cite the origin and date. We avoid unverifiable claims and sensational headlines.
Editorial Process & Fact-Checking
- Drafting: Articles are written by our in-house team led by Prashant SN (M.Com).
- Verification: Key facts (rates, limits, section numbers, dates) are checked against primary sources.
- Examples: We include worked ₹ examples and clearly state assumptions and limits.
- Review: A second pass checks clarity, neutrality and citation completeness before publishing.
